To maintain student engagement, educators should adopt a mindset of flexibility and openness to new ideas. This approach allows instructors to adapt their teaching methods and materials to better suit the diverse learning styles and interests of their students. When educators are willing to incorporate innovative techniques, respond to feedback, and adjust their lesson plans in real-time, they create a dynamic learning environment that encourages participation and enthusiasm.

Flexibility enables educators to introduce new concepts, incorporate technology, and explore various teaching strategies that resonate with students, making the learning experience more relevant and stimulating. This adaptability can foster a sense of community within the classroom, where students feel valued and heard, significantly enhancing their motivation and engagement.

In contrast, adopting a conservative approach in teaching techniques or a rigid curriculum can stifle creativity and discourage student participation. Furthermore, a dominant stance in classroom discussions can create an imbalance where students may feel intimidated to share their thoughts, leading to a disengaged classroom environment. Emphasizing flexibility and openness ultimately cultivates a more inclusive and interactive atmosphere conducive to learning.
